I remember that some months ago there was some discussion about how to
generate both API and source level documentation for XSLTs.

The first step obviously would be to have an XSLT that transforms XLST +
comments into an HTML form which is more readable. This could (depending on
params), include the (beautified) source and links into XSLT on-line
documentation as well.

In addition, it might make sense to define an extension namespace, so we can
embed own elements (descriptions holding XHTML) and so on...

Does anything like this already exist? If yes, where? If no, who would be
willing to co-operate on a project like this?
